Causes and treatments for yellow rose leaves

Causes and treatments for yellow rose leaves

1. Improper watering

1. Reason: Improper watering may cause its leaves to turn yellow. Too much watering will cause water accumulation at the roots and reduce the ability to absorb water; too little watering will result in less moisture in the soil. All of these will lead to less water absorption by the roots and yellowing of the leaves.

2. Treatment: If you water too much, you should reduce the amount of watering and place it in a cool place; if you water too little, you should increase the frequency and amount of watering.

2. Improper fertilization

1. Reason: Fertilizing too early, applying fertilizer at an inappropriate time, or choosing an inappropriate type of fertilizer may affect its growth, causing it to grow sluggishly and its leaves to turn yellow.

2. Treatment method: Fertilization should be applied in autumn and not just after planting. Fertilizers should not be too concentrated, and more dilute fertilizers and nitrogen-containing fertilizers should be applied. If individual plants grow small, you can apply a small amount of foliar fertilizer on the surface. If the plant has yellow leaves due to concentrated fertilizer, it is necessary to remove it from the pot, wash the roots and change the soil in time.

3. Plant Disease

1. Cause: Common rose diseases such as powdery mildew and rust will cause the plant to grow sluggishly, and these diseases may cause the leaves to turn yellow during the onset of the disease.

2. Treatment method: Spray the medicine in time to solve the disease. If powdery mildew occurs, you can spray triadimefon solution; if rust occurs, spray 800 times triadimefon, spray once a week, and spray for one month to cure it.
